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Mckeesport | San Antonio |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 4,258.7 | 5,219.0 | -960.3 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 1,693.7 | 595.3 | +1,098.4 |
| Murder Rate | 32.5 | 8.4 | +24.1 |
| Rape Rate | 32.5 | 83.7 | -51.2 |
| Robbery Rate | 162.3 | 108.4 | +54.0 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 1,466.5 | 393.7 | +1,072.7 |
| Property Crime Rate | 2,564.9 | 4,623.6 | -2,058.7 |
| Burglary Rate | 589.8 | 495.6 | +94.3 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 1,672.1 | 3,291.8 | -1,619.7 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 303.0 | 836.3 | -533.2 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Mckeesport, PA
McKeesport, a Monongahela River town, was once a thriving steel hub home to the National Tube Works. Its population has seen a steady decline since the mid-20th century. With a safety score of 7/100 and a population coverage of 18,480, Mckeesport has a total crime rate of 4,258.7 per 100,000 residents.
About San Antonio, TX
San Antonio, a South Texas city famed for the Alamo, sits along the Balcones Escarpment. Its population is predominantly Hispanic, reflecting a rich blend of cultures. With a safety score of 3/100 and a population coverage of 1,514,458, San Antonio has a total crime rate of 5,219.0 per 100,000 residents.
